Signatory Cragganmore 1989

Brand Signatory
Expression Cragganmore 1989
Type Scotch Whisky / Single Malt
Vintage 1989
Abv 55.70%
Produced at Signatory Vintage Scotch Whisky Co. Ltd.
Region Speyside
Availability UK, selected European countries and Japan
Guide Price £18-£25 (US$30-US$40)

Tasting Notes

Michael Jackson

Nose
Creamy, herbal, flowery.
Palate
Complex, with very tightly combined flavours, gradually revealing cut grass and thyme, but somewhat dried out.
Finish
Austere even by Cragganmore standards.
Comment
Not very old, but was the cask a little tired?

Dave Broom

Nose
Obvious alcohol when neat. Slightly hard and austere: graphite, oak, some heather, grass and very light touches of vanilla and fruit.
Palate
Sweet and gentle. Very light.
Finish
Lightly fruity.
Comment
Lacks the complexity you expect from Cragganmore.
